#890667 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#890667 is composed of 53.7% red, 2.4%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.6% magenta, 24.8%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 315.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 28%. #890667 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cce with #130000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#890667 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#890667 has RGB values of R:137, G:6,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.25,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 8980071.

Shades and Tints of #890667
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050004 is the darkest color, while #fef2fb is the lightest one.
